Understanding the Role of ∅19×25 Cap Tip in Welding and Cutting Equipment

2026-07-25 11:10

In the realm of industrial equipment, especially in welding and cutting processes, the components play a crucial role in ensuring efficiency, precision, and safety. One such component that has garnered attention is the ∅19×25 cap tip. This specialized tip is commonly used in a variety of welding applications, acting as a connector that enhances the performance of welding guns and cutting torches.

The ∅19×25 cap tip is characterized by its specific dimensions—outer diameter of 19mm and a length of 25mm—allowing it to fit seamlessly into various welding and cutting devices. Its design is tailored to accommodate different welding techniques, such as MIG, TIG, and stick welding, making it a versatile choice for professionals across several industries.
One of the primary functions of the cap tip is to direct the flow of shielding gas or plasma during the welding or cutting process. This not only helps in protecting the weld zone from atmospheric contamination but also aids in stabilizing the arc. A well-designed cap tip can significantly improve the quality of the weld or cut, leading to stronger joints and cleaner edges. By providing a consistent gas flow and maintaining optimal temperature, the ∅19×25 cap tip allows for improved control over the welding process, which is crucial for achieving desired results.
Moreover, the material composition of the cap tip is essential. Typically, these tips are made from durable materials that can withstand high temperatures and resist wear, ensuring longevity and reliability in demanding environments. The right material choice can also reduce the frequency of replacements, ultimately saving time and costs associated with downtime and maintenance.
It’s also important to consider compatibility when selecting a cap tip. Professionals need to ensure that the ∅19×25 cap tip is suitable for their specific welding equipment. This includes checking the connection types and ensuring that the tip fits securely without causing leaks or interruptions in the gas flow. Proper installation and maintenance of the cap tip are crucial for optimal performance, and regular inspections can help identify any wear that may affect its functionality.
